Profile Summary

Nastaran Emaminejad is a PhD candidate in Medical Physics at University of California at Los Angeles under supervision of Dr. Michael Mc-Nitt Gray and Dr. Matthew Brown. Her research interest focuses on quantitative medical imaging. She has been involved in developing and working with common computer aided diagnosis tools by using of machine learning and computer vision in providing precision medicine.
